City Council Meeting Minutes September 7, 2021 <br />• Stormwater Fund <br />- Rate increase from 8.0% to 8.5% ($32,500) to fund needed maintenance costs <br />(cost neutral) <br />• Airport Fund <br />- Add new grant revenue ($90,500) with offset increase in contractual costs <br />(cost neutral) <br />FY22 Budget General Fund Personnel Breakdown of public safety is 53%, <br />Community Development is 12%, Parks and Recreation is 9%, Public Works is <br />7%, Neighborhood Enhancement is 4%, Technology Services is 4%, Finance & <br />Human Resources 6% Administrative 5% <br />Ms. Kalka mentioned for FY22 General fund summary the Community <br />Enhancement Fee will be removed from General Fund and moved to new <br />Special Revenue Fund. <br />Mayor Hughson opened the Public Hearing at 6:37 p.m. <br />There being no speakers, Mayor Hughson closed the Public Hearing at 6:37 <br />p.m. <br />Deputy Mayor Pro Tem Scott inquired about uploading the budget into the <br />info graphics program and uploaded to our website for easier viewing by <br />citizens. Mr. Lumbreras stated staff is re-evaluating that program. Ms. Kalka <br />stated she met with the vendor and there is no contract at this time so to load <br />it, there would need to be a contract in place. Open GOV is currently utilized <br />and will be posted with them this year. Mr. Lumbreras stated he will look into <br />this, understanding a contract is in place with another vendor, but staff will <br />research and provide information to Council. <br />MOTION TO AMEND: a motion was made by Mayor Hughson, seconded by <br />Council Member Gleason, to amend Section 3 (c -f) of the Ordinance by adding <br />"with notification to the city council members". This section will now read as <br />follows: <br />The City Manager is authorized to make the following adjustments to the <br />2021-2022 Annual Budget without further approval from the City Council: <br />(a) Transfers of funds among the accounts within each department; <br />(b) Transfers of funds within an operating fund; <br />(c) Transfers of funds for construction projects and equipment purchases from <br />operating accounts to Capital Improvements Program accounts with <br />notification to the city council members; <br />City of San Marcos Paye 6 <br />
